Abstract
This paper analyses the influence of the conductivity ration, Phi(lambda), and the volume heat capacity ration, Phi(h), on the conjugate heat transfer from a liquid particle in a liquid environment. Both creeping flow and mod erate Re number domain are considered. Special attention is given to the ph enomenon of thermal wake. The occurrence and the evolution of the thermal w ake depend on the values of volume heat capacity ratio and conductivity rat io respectively. The influence of the Pe numbers on the thermal inversion p henomenon and the interaction (at moderate Re number values) between therma l wake and flow separation are analysed. The results obtained show that Phi (lambda) and Phi(h) influence strongly the conjugate heat transfer.
